About

The character 核, structured with the wood radical 木 and the phonetic component 亥, initially specifically referred to the hard pit or stone found inside fruits, directly linking its meaning to botanical elements. Its semantic scope broadened over time to metaphorically indicate the central or most essential part of any entity or idea, such as the core of a matter. This extended meaning later provided the basis for its application in modern scientific terminology, where it denotes atomic nuclei and related concepts like nuclear physics. The compositional integrity of the character has been maintained, with 木 consistently signaling its original plant-related sense and 亥 functioning as a phonetic indicator.
